Faith Hill parents: Who are Faith Hill parents?
Faith Hill was born Audrey Faith Perry, and was adopted as a baby by Edna and Ted Perry, who nurtured her with a strong Christian upbringing in Star, Mississippi. Despite not knowing her biological parents, Hill cherished her adoptive family’s openness about her adoption, which allowed her to embrace her background with confidence. Hill’s musical…

Faith Hill first husband: Meet Daniel Hill
In 1988, Faith Hill tied the knot with Daniel Hill, stepping into marriage at the tender age of 21. Daniel, a music publishing executive, crossed paths with Faith while she worked as a secretary in the same industry. Their shared love for music likely kindled their romance, leading to a union after a year and…

Is Faith Hill related to Steve Perry?
Faith Hill and Steve Perry are actually related, but, not in the way fans might imagine. Steve Perry isn’t Faith Hill’s biological father; he’s her adoptive brother. Faith Hill, originally Audrey Faith Perry, was adopted as a baby by Ted and Edna Perry, who already had two sons, Wesley and Steve. Consequently, they’re siblings through…
